Gaming Industry Growth and Skilled Workforce

The booming gaming industry is a major driver of economic growth, creating a surge in demand for skilled professionals. The San Antonio Sports & Entertainment District, if realized, could capitalize on this trend by attracting game developers, esports teams, and other gaming-related businesses. This influx of talent would not only boost the local economy but also establish San Antonio as a hub for innovation and creativity in the gaming world.
According to the Entertainment Software Association, the video game industry generated over $57 billion in revenue in the United States in 2022. This growth is fueled by the increasing popularity of esports, mobile gaming, and virtual reality. San Antonio, with its strong entrepreneurial spirit and growing tech sector, is well-positioned to tap into this lucrative market.

Addressing Concerns about Noise and Traffic
Large-scale gaming events and a bustling entertainment district can generate noise and traffic congestion. The city must carefully plan infrastructure and transportation solutions to mitigate these impacts. Implementing noise buffers, public transportation options, and designated event parking areas will be crucial for ensuring a positive experience for both residents and visitors.
